Country artist Blake Shelton released his cover of "Ol' Red" in 2002. The song was originally recorded by George Jones in 1990, and covered by Kenny Rogers in 1993.

What country does the last name Shelton come from?

The last name Shelton is Anglo Saxon and English in origin. It was first used in the Bedfordshire, Nottinghamshire and Norfolk areas.


Who wrote come on feel the noise?

It was written by Jim Lea and Noddy Holder, and was originally released by Slade in 1973.
